Zelensky said that Russia will beat Ukrainian missile manufacturers

The launch of the Zircon hypersonic cruise missile from the Admiral Gorshkov frigate. Photo: mil.ru

The head of the Kiev regime, Vladimir Zelensky, said that Russia would intensify attacks on Ukrainian missile manufacturers. He stated this in his telegram channel after a meeting with the head of the Main Directorate of the Ministry of Defense of Ukraine Oleg Ivashchenko.

"It is known that Ukrainian companies demonstrating progress in the development of all types of missile technologies have been selected as one of the key areas for further Russian strikes on Ukraine — military, political and propaganda. Russia defines this as a strategic threat to itself — Ukraine's ability to develop its own ballistic system and localize the production of anti-ballistic defense. We will react," Zelensky writes.

According to him, Ivashchenko also reported details about the Russian production of missiles — "objects, distances, quantity, supply routes of critical components and machine tools, as well as individuals and companies from other countries that help Russia circumvent sanctions."

"We are preparing an update of our countermeasures — Ukrainian and in coordination with partners," Zelensky threatened.

As reported by EADaily, the head of the Kiev regime, Vladimir Zelensky, said that the West was preventing Ukraine from launching its ballistic missiles. He told reporters about this during a visit to Sweden, where he is now.

Zelensky's statement was broadcast on United News.
